Output eaf2eca54d74a8d18a73163d77ddcbe07fa515545f03d29f7d70a429c7e45d0e:6

value
63888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bca30187a84a181f5992d949c52e4afc1e80029a OP_EQUAL
address
3JtSETjGFXhSJni8jwr2U26MVtTGgWfkLG
transaction
eaf2eca54d74a8d18a73163d77ddcbe07fa515545f03d29f7d70a429c7e45d0e
spent
true